Hello friendly list,

I've eagerly upgraded to Ekiga 3.0 and, after running the configuration
druid (and re-entering all my account info by hand from the old
ekiga.conf), suddenly find myself with troubles.  My ekiga.net account
gives a "Could not register(Timeout)" status, and while my
sip.diamondcard.us account will register, making calls doesn't seem to
work at all---I click the green phone button, and Ekiga just sits there
until I click the red phone button.

Things I've tried: lowering my firewall (although it used to work with my
firewall up before), killing all other sound-making apps (although my
default audio devices in ALSA are dmix and dsnoop), making sure ekiga.net
isn't down (the web server isn't, at any rate), double-checking all my
passwords, reading the man page, scouring the wiki, restarting Ekiga,
rebooting my machine, and praying.

Can anyone help?

Please enable only one account and post a -d 4 output somehwere.
